I was in the SW part of the park through the 19th. I was truly amazed at the absence of insect populations during my 2 week trip. Mosquitoes were virtually non-existent during most of the trip and were only bothersome of a few swampy portage landings during later stages of the trip. I saw ONE tick, and it wasn't on me. There were a few black flies and horse flies, but they weren't overly aggressive. Gnats were present throughout the trip, but weren't developing into a nuisance until the last couple of days.


For the record ... this is the lowest presence of insects I witnessed for any May/June trip I've taken (which is well over a dozen).

Mayflies are starting to hatch as well as several stoneflies. The common house fly and horesfly made an entrance this past week. I actually welcome nightfall so that only the "usual" mosquito visitors were there to contend with. With wind and some cool overnight temperatures came relief :)
